Abstract

For automatic detections of domains in SiFe sheets, field sensors of both, small effective area and very high sensitivity, are needed. In the case of the described sensor, high sensitivity is attained by means of a commercially available Hall plate with integrated pre-amplifier. Small effective area and close contact to the specimen are attained by means of a 25 μm thick strip of soft magnetic amorphous material, which is used as a bridge between sample and Hall plate. The presented results demonstrate that main domains of stress coated transformer sheets can be detected in an effective way.
